Title: A rigorous approach to topological order in the thermodynamic limit

Abstract: In recent years, the analysis of topologically ordered ground states of 2d quantum lattice systems in the thermodynamic limit has been developed to provide a rigorous invariant of gapped phases. The methodology is based on the approach of Doplicher, Haag, and Roberts in the context of algebraic quantum field theory, and derives a braided C*-tensor category representing the anyonic excitations of the ground state, and the fusion and braiding among them. We present the computation of this category for a complete class of commuting projector Hamiltonians, the Levin-Wen models, based on joint work with Alex Bols.
